Effect of multiple scattering on experimental Compton profiles: a Monte Carlo calculation

Abstract A Monte Carlo technique is used to calculate the total intensity and spectral distribution of multiple scattered photons in a typical γ-ray Compton scattering experiment. The method can be used to correct experimental Compton profiles for the effect of multiple scattering. The procedure is applied to two profiles of water measured on samples of different thicknesses and the resultant corrected profiles are seen to be independent of the original sample thickness; furthermore their agreement with a recent calculation using a near Hartree-Fock wave function is significantly improved.
